Types Of Concrete Foundations

Concrete foundations serve a critical role in the stability and longevity of any structure, as they provide the necessary support for the entire building. A number of key types of concrete foundations are available, each tailored to specific soil conditions and construction needs. The most common types include slab foundations, which feature one continuous, thick layer of concrete; crawl space foundations, which raise structures off the ground; and basement foundations, which offer extra living space and storage capacity. Every type carries distinct advantages, such as straightforward construction, budget efficiency, or superior insulation. Understanding these variations is vital for selecting the appropriate foundation that matches the particular demands of the project, ensuring a solid base for any construction endeavor.

Significance Of Correct Reinforcement

Reinforcement functions as a vital factor in ensuring the strength and durability of concrete foundations. Proper reinforcement techniques, such as the use of steel rebar or fibrous materials, improve the overall structural integrity by supplying tensile strength that unreinforced concrete is unable to offer. This combination successfully reduces the likelihood of cracking and foundation failure under diverse environmental conditions and loads. Moreover, adequate reinforcement allows for better stress distribution throughout the foundation structure, promoting overall performance and longevity. Engineers must consider elements including soil conditions and load requirements when designing reinforcement plans. By emphasizing adequate reinforcement, property owners can safeguard their investments and confirm the foundations are equipped to withstand the challenges of time, ultimately supporting the entire structure effectively.

Methods For Foundation Repair

Foundation repair methods serve a critical purpose in preserving the stability of buildings, especially when challenges emerge from poor reinforcement or surrounding environmental influences. Common methods include underpinning, a process that reinforces the foundation by reaching deeper into solid ground, and slab jacking, wherein a compound is injected below concrete slabs to elevate residential & commercial Concrete and even them out. Another technique is helical piers, which are installed to provide support in unstable soil conditions. Additionally, wall anchors can stabilize bowing walls by redistributing forces. All approaches are adapted to individual issues, providing reliable solutions and enhancing the durability of the structure. A thorough evaluation by qualified experts is necessary to identify the most suitable method for effective foundation restoration.

Sturdy Walkway Choices

How can homeowners ensure their walkways are both useful and attractive? Picking sturdy materials makes all the difference. Concrete emerges as a top selection due to its durability and adaptability. Choices like stamped concrete enable imaginative patterns, mimicking natural stone or brick, while offering exceptional durability against weather and foot traffic. Furthermore, homeowners can explore adding decorative aggregates for enhanced texture and aesthetic appeal. For those prioritizing environmentally conscious choices, permeable concrete allows for water drainage, reducing puddling and erosion. Moreover, adding complementary lighting can enhance safety and aesthetics during nighttime. By thoughtfully combining these elements, homeowners can build walkways that not only endure through the seasons but also elevate the overall charm of their outdoor spaces.

Creative Methods in Decorative Concrete Finishes

Transforming ordinary surfaces into stunning works of art, cutting-edge approaches in decorative concrete finishes have become increasingly favored among architects and designers. These methods enhance aesthetic appeal while providing durability and functionality. Processes such as stamping, staining, and engraving provide a broad spectrum of textures and colors, replicating materials like stone or wood without the related upkeep expenses.

Stenciling offers elaborate designs, facilitating unique patterns that can personalize any space. Moreover, the application of exposed aggregate highlights unique stone combinations, adding a natural touch to various surfaces.

Latest developments, highlighted by the introduction of eco-friendly pigments and sealers, have additionally enhanced the environmental responsibility of ornamental concrete surfaces. By incorporating state-of-the-art technology, industry experts can deliver vibrant colors and long-lasting results.

Tips for Maintaining and Caring for Your Concrete Installations

Once you have selected a skilled concrete specialist, looking after concrete structures becomes vital to secure their longevity and functionality. Consistent maintenance is important; debris and stains should be removed promptly to stop deterioration. A moderate pressure rinse can effectively eliminate buildup and contaminants while keeping the surface intact.

Protecting concrete surfaces every few years is critical to protect against moisture infiltration and staining. This not only enhances appearance but also increases durability. In the winter season, the utilization of de-icing agents must be prevented, as they can cause cracks and surface flaking.

Cracks ought to be handled promptly with the proper repair compounds to stop further degradation. Additionally, heavy loads should be managed to eliminate excessive pressure on the concrete surface. By implementing these care routines, homeowners can ensure their concrete installations remain functional and aesthetically pleasing for years to come.

How Long Will Concrete Normally Last Before Repairs Are Needed?

Concrete commonly survives 30 to 40 years on average before requiring repairs, influenced by factors such as climate conditions, material quality, and upkeep practices. Routine inspections help prolong its lifespan and catch problems early.

Can Concrete Be Repurposed After Its Useful Life?

Yes, concrete may be recycled after its useful life. It is regularly ground up and utilized as base material in fresh concrete mixes or utilized in additional building applications, thereby cutting down on waste while protecting natural resources.

How Does Weather Impact Concrete Curing Times?

Atmospheric conditions have a major impact on concrete curing times. Warmer temperatures cause moisture to evaporate more rapidly, while cold temperatures may slow down the hardening process. Humidity also plays a role, with excessive moisture potentially leading to surface issues, ultimately impacting the strength and longevity of the concrete.
